import xml.etree.ElementTree as ET
import json
from typing import Any, Dict
import logging
def parse_last_change_event(xml_text: str, logger: logging.Logger) -> Dict[str, Any]:
"""
Parses the LastChange event XML from UPnP services.
AVTransport and RenderingControl typically use this.
The XML structure is
or for AVTransport:
"""
changed_variables: Dict[str, Any] = {}
try:
# Remove default namespace for easier parsing if present
xml_text = xml_text.replace(
' xmlns="urn:schemas-upnp-org:metadata-1-0/RCS/"', ""
)
xml_text = xml_text.replace(
' xmlns="urn:schemas-upnp-org:metadata-1-0/AVT/"', ""
)
xml_text = xml_text.replace(
' xmlns="urn:schemas-wiimu-com:metadata-1-0/PlayQueue/"', ""
)
root = ET.fromstring(xml_text)
instance_id_node = root.find("InstanceID") or root.find("QueueID")
if instance_id_node is None:
logger.warning(
"No InstanceID found in LastChange event XML: %s", xml_text[:200]
)
return changed_variables
for child in instance_id_node:
variable_name = child.tag
value = child.get("val")
channel = child.get("channel")
if variable_name == "Volume" or variable_name == "Mute":
if variable_name not in changed_variables:
changed_variables[variable_name] = []
channel_data = {"val": value}
if channel:
channel_data["channel"] = channel
changed_variables[variable_name].append(channel_data)
elif (
variable_name == "CurrentTrackMetaData"
or variable_name == "AVTransportURIMetaData"
or variable_name == "NextAVTransportURIMetaData"
):
# Metadata can arrive as JSON or DIDL-Lite XML depending on source/app.
try:
if value is None:
continue
raw_value = value.strip()
if raw_value.startswith("{") or raw_value.startswith("["):
changed_variables[variable_name] = json.loads(raw_value)
continue
didl_root = ET.fromstring(value)
item_node = didl_root.find(
".//{urn:schemas-upnp-org:metadata-1-0/DIDL-Lite/}item"
)
if item_node is not None:
meta: Dict[str, Any] = {}
title_node = item_node.find(
"{http://purl.org/dc/elements/1.1/}title"
)
if title_node is not None:
meta["title"] = title_node.text
artist_node = item_node.find(
"{urn:schemas-upnp-org:metadata-1-0/upnp/}artist"
)
if artist_node is not None:
meta["artist"] = artist_node.text
album_node = item_node.find(
"{urn:schemas-upnp-org:metadata-1-0/upnp/}album"
)
if album_node is not None:
meta["album"] = album_node.text
art_node = item_node.find(
"{urn:schemas-upnp-org:metadata-1-0/upnp/}albumArtURI"
)
if art_node is not None:
meta["albumArtURI"] = art_node.text
res_node = item_node.find(
".//{urn:schemas-upnp-org:metadata-1-0/DIDL-Lite/}res"
)
if res_node is not None:
meta["res"] = res_node.text
meta["duration"] = res_node.get("duration")
changed_variables[variable_name] = meta
else:
changed_variables[variable_name] = (
value # Store raw if not parsable as DIDL
)
except json.JSONDecodeError:
if value:
logger.debug(
"Failed to parse metadata JSON for %s: %s",
variable_name,
value[:100],
)
changed_variables[variable_name] = value
except ET.ParseError:
if value:
logger.debug(
"Failed to parse metadata XML for %s: %s",
variable_name,
value[:100],
)
changed_variables[variable_name] = value # Store raw XML
elif variable_name == "LoopMpde" or variable_name == "LoopMode":
# interpret as integer if possible
try:
changed_variables[variable_name] = (
int(value) if value is not None else 4
)
except ValueError:
changed_variables[variable_name] = 4
else:
changed_variables[variable_name] = value
logger.debug("Parsed LastChange event: %s", changed_variables)
except ET.ParseError as e:
logger.error(
"Error parsing LastChange event XML: %s\nXML: %s", e, xml_text[:500]
) # Log more XML on error
return changed_variables
